Ah, so, I have a 10 1/2 year old girl.
She has just recently started rolling her eyes a lot, bursting into sobs when we least expecting it, slamming her bedroom door a few times (that's not allowed), and insisting that I don't know anything.

When she was four, we were at the zoo and she told a total stranger I was the "smartest lady in the whole world!"

Now I apparently know very little. And she knows everything.

God help me. I think I need a support group. If this starts early, does that mean it ends earlier????

2. I have three daughters, and the behaviors you
describe is quite typical at her age.

One book that I've found that really helped with my parenting is, "Yes, Your Teen is Crazy - Loving Your Kid Without Losing Your Mind" by Michael Bradley. I highly recommend it.

Don't worry, your little girl will get over this behavior. It may take years, but she will. The end result is wonderful - speaking from experience :)
